Former City striker poised for big-money switch
Skysports.com understands former Manchester City striker Felipe Caicedo is set to join Lokomotiv Moscow from Levante for €10million.
The Ecuador international moved to Eastlands in a £5.2million deal in January 2008 but was unable to force his way into the first-team picture.
Loan spells with Sporting and Malaga followed before the 22-year-old joined Levante on a season-long loan last summer with a view to a permanent deal.
The Spanish side immediately took up that option after Caicedo impressed and weighed in with 14 goals for the Primera Liga club.
But they shelled out just €1million (£868,000) for his services and are now set to make a handsome profit for the powerful forward.
Caicedo has recently been on international duty at the Copa America where he bagged two goals in Ecuador's three games.
